Tschortowez ( Ukrainian Чортовець ; Russian Чертовец Tschertowez , Polish Czortowiec ) is a village in the east of the Ukrainian Oblast Ivano-Frankivsk with about 3000 inhabitants (2001).
The village, first mentioned in writing in 1479 (another source after 1446), was called Nazarenkowe ( Назаренкове ) between 1977 and 1993 . Tschortowez is the only village of the same name, 47.628 km² large district council in the west of Horodenka Rajon .
The village is located in the east of the historical Galicia 18 km west of the Horodenka district center and 63 km southeast of the Ivano-Frankivsk oblast center .
